Description

IL1A encodes interleukin-1 alpha (IL-1α), a potent pro-inflammatory cytokine produced mainly by activated macrophages, epithelial cells, and fibroblasts. IL-1α is synthesized as a precursor (pro-IL-1α) that can be cleaved by calpain to release the mature, active form. It binds to the IL-1 receptor (IL-1R1) and recruits the IL-1 receptor accessory protein (IL-1RAcP), triggering NF-κB and MAPK signaling pathways. IL-1α plays a central role in acute and chronic inflammation, fever, hematopoiesis, and immune responses. Dysregulation of IL1A is implicated in autoinflammatory diseases, cancer, and metabolic disorders.

Protein Summary

IL-1α is a 271-amino-acid precursor protein (31 kDa) that is cleaved by calpain to generate the mature 17.5 kDa form. The precursor contains an N-terminal propiece that can translocate to the nucleus and regulate transcription. The mature cytokine adopts a β-trefoil fold and binds IL-1R1 with high affinity. IL-1α is stored intracellularly and released upon cell damage or activation, acting as an alarmin. It is a key mediator of sterile inflammation and is targeted therapeutically by anakinra (IL-1R antagonist) and canakinumab (anti-IL-1β antibody, though IL-1α is not directly neutralized).
